Vertica Database Administrator (DBA)  Data & BI Platform Engineering     EIS

Full time – Springfield or Boston

The Opportunity

We are seeking a highly skilled Vertica DBA to join our team and help support multiple Vertica EON clustered environments. This role is pivotal in ensuring the reliability, scalability, and security of our data infrastructure. The ideal candidate will combine deep technical expertise with a collaborative, solutions-driven mindset, supporting mission-critical operations and driving continuous improvement across our database landscape.

  • Production Support & Monitoring:
    Provide 24/7/365 support for Vertica database systems, ensuring high availability, rapid incident response, and proactive performance monitoring across clustered environments.
  • Database Administration:
    Oversee all aspects of Vertica database technology, including backup and recovery, server architecture, performance tuning, security, encryption, auditing, metadata management, optimization, statistics, capacity planning, connectivity, and other data solutions for mission-critical systems.
  • Problem Solving & Optimization:
    Tackle complex business challenges related to data processing, loading, performance improvements, storage, and replication. Apply advanced troubleshooting skills to stabilize and optimize database operations.
  • Technical Leadership:
    Collaborate closely with technical teams, providing expert guidance on best practices for database technology and distributed deployments. Mentor peers and contribute to a culture of knowledge sharing.
  • Automation & Process Improvement:
    Design and implement automation for database monitoring and alerting. Drive continuous improvement by developing and standardizing operational procedures.
  • Capacity & License Management:
    Monitor Vertica capacity planning and license management to ensure efficient resource utilization and compliance.
  • Data Integrity & Utility Management:
    Maintain data integrity through effective utility and disk management procedures, safeguarding the reliability and accuracy of enterprise data.

The Minimum Qualifications

  • Bachelor’s Degree in Computer Engineering, Computer Science, Information Systems or related technical field
  • 8+ years of hands-on experience with Enterprise Data Warehousing.
  • 5+ years of experience in SQL, with a track record of writing and optimizing complex queries.
  • 3+ years of Vertica-specific database support, management, and administration.

The Ideal Qualifications

  • Proven experience supporting mission-critical applications in dynamic enterprise environments.
  • Demonstrated expertise supporting Vertica in cloud environments (preferably AWS).
  • In-depth knowledge of Vertica physical and logical architecture.
  • Familiarity with optimization techniques such as projections and partitioning.
  • Solid understanding of ETL processes, data structures, metadata, and workflow management.
  • Strong Linux OS skills, including proficiency with tracing and performance tools.
  • Experience with resource pool tuning for optimal performance.
  • Innovative mindset with a passion for problem-solving and process improvement.
  • Team-oriented approach, prioritizing collaboration and shared success.
  • Experience with Voltage encryption solutions.
  • Proficiency in AWS infrastructure, including:
    • Terraform
    • Python
    • EC2
    • IAM
    • Autoscaling
    • Cost management
  • Hands-on experience with New Relic for monitoring and alerting.
